8-5-13 no serve policy

Fond du Lac police say a no-serve policy for drunks may be something Fond du Lac bar owners  should explore.   The Janesville Police Department is the latest Wisconsin law enforcement agency to ask local taverns and liquor stores not to serve people who are habitually intoxicated.  Under Janesville’s policy an individual with three or more alcohol-related incidents that result in a police call within a six month period is placed on the no-serve list.  Fond dulac Assistant Police Chief Steve Klein says while Fond du Lac’s  no-serve policy doesn’t go as far as Janesville, it is similar.  Klein says Fond du Lac police generally have a good relationship with the  Fond du Lac bar and liquor store owners.
